WebApr 6, 2024 · Stockings were popular with ‘flappers’. Rebellious young American women of the 1920’s who wore short skirts, bobbed their hair, danced to Jazz music and ignored what society considered to be ‘acceptable’ at the time. Stockings in this period came up to just above the knee and had to be secured with a garter belt.
